Welcome to on-call for the Glimmerpane design system! Our snapshot tests live in the `snapcheck` suite and run on every merge to main. If a UI component changes visually, the diff bot flags it — usually it's an intentional tweak, so just approve the new baseline. If it's 2am and snapshots are failing across the board, it's almost always a font-loading race, not your problem. To unlock the baseline store and re-approve snapshots in bulk, use the recovery passphrase below.

recovery phrase for tahag-taguf: wenix-caswyn

**TICKET-4182: Signature check fails on reset links (Passkey revamp)**

New Corvid reset flow rejects ~8% of links with `sig_mismatch`. Cause: verifier still loads the pre-revamp key while the issuer rotated last Tuesday. Fix: pin both services to the current key until rollout completes. Blocking the revamp GA; flagging for eng sync. Current issuer signing key for verification is below.

rollout seal: bky4_sSmA

## Idempotency Keys for Payment Retries (Lumopay)

Every retry of a charge request must reuse the original idempotency key; generating a new key on retry can produce duplicate charges. Keys are scoped per merchant and expire after 48 hours. Reviewers should verify keys are derived server-side, never from client input. The full key-generation specification and threat model are maintained on the internal page.

dashboard of kaguf-tawip = https://vault.merlaqsys.test/issue